Strengths and Limitations of the Graduation Cap Tassel Design
Like any design, the Graduation Cap Tassel Earring Laser Cut has specific strengths and constraints that should be considered before production.
Key Strengths:
- High recognition value: The graduation cap is a universally understood symbol, making the design immediately relatable for graduates and gift-givers.
- Seasonal relevance: Demand for graduation-themed items spikes in late spring and early summer, making this a timely product for annual sales cycles.
- Multiple file formats: Ensures compatibility with a wide range of laser cutters and crafting machines, supporting both hobbyists and small-scale manufacturers.
- Elegant yet simple: The design avoids overcomplication, which helps maintain clarity when cut in smaller sizes or with less-detailed materials.
Potential Limitations:
- Thematic limitation: While ideal for graduation events, the design may have less year-round appeal compared to more general jewelry styles like geometric shapes or minimalist silhouettes.
- Detail constraints: Depending on the material and laser settings, some of the finer tassel lines may be delicate and require reinforcement for durability.
- Market saturation: Graduation-themed jewelry is a competitive category, so differentiation through material choice or packaging may be necessary.

Practical Applications and Real-World Examples
Many small-scale jewelry makers have successfully used the Graduation Cap Tassel Earring Laser Cut to create unique, marketable items. For example:
- Wooden earrings: Crafted from laser-cut birch plywood, these offer a natural, rustic aesthetic that appeals to eco-conscious buyers.
- Acrylic versions: Clear or colored acrylics provide a modern, lightweight option that’s ideal for everyday wear.
- Metal iterations: Using brass or stainless steel gives the design a more luxurious finish, suitable for commemorative gifts or keepsakes.
These variations demonstrate how the same base design can be adapted to suit different aesthetics and customer preferences. By experimenting with materials, finishes, and presentation, creators can maximize the design’s versatility.
